Beer Review: New Belgium Cherry Almond Ale
The Cherry Almond Ale from New Belgium Brewing is I guess what one could call a fruit ale in how it may be described for a style. The beer provides a great appearance with its reddish brown color and nice tannish and foamy head. Drinking this brought up images and tastes associated with chocolate covered cherries. This definitely played out as a malt forward beer and of course that is no surprise considering the IBU on this ale is only 16. And at an ABV of 5.8% the beer doesn’t play out too heavy, although its sweetness could become a factor for some. Check out my video below to see more of my thoughts on this limited availability ale.
With a vibrant splash of cherry, and gentle chocolate aromas, our Cherry Almond Ale delicately balances malty sweetness with a refreshingly bitter finish. Find it only in Folly Packs in early 2017.
VISUAL: Bright ruby/mahogany color with a light off-white foam.
AROMA: Coffee, roasted malt and chocolate initially with some caramel, cherries, cola and nuts, slight smoke.
FLAVOR: Sweet throughout with very subtle sour middle and a mild lingering bitterness.
MOUTHFEEL: Starts lightly coating, finishes astringent.
BODY: Medium body.
ABV: 5.8
IBU: 16
YEAST: Ale
HOPS: Nugget, Cascade
MALTS: Pale, Munich, C-120, Victory, Black Prinz

Beer Review: Lagunitas Lagunator Lager
The Lag or Lagunator Lager is a California Common from Lagunitas Brewing that provides a nice amount of maltiness with a little bit of bite from the hops used. I decided to pick up this bottle as my curiosity was aroused, especially as it is also related to being a bock. Check out my video located below to see my full insights on this beer.
Brewer Notes:
It’s a dry-hopped California Common with a massive malt character, rounded out by a bitter balance from some experimental hops from the Yakima Valley; this beer will leave you saying ‘I’ll be bock!’
AVAILABILITY: May - June
IBU/ABV: 42 / 7.7%
INTRODUCED: 06/1998
SOLD AS: 22 Oz. and On Tap
Beer Review: Avery Hog Heaven
I always enjoy a good Imperial IPA and Hog Heaven from Avery Brewing Company was one that I happened to find on a local beer run and was looking forward to trying. Pouring a nice reddish color as an Imperial Red IPA the beer did provide a nice appearance. But what really surprised me was that with the high IBU noted on Untappd as 104, the beer played smoother than expected. Side note, Avery should really provide this detail on their website so it can be easily seen. But back to the beer, the flavor and taste was very decent and there is a great balance between the malts and the hops. This applied to a good finish definitely makes it worth a try, and was part of the reason why I scored this one on Untappd as 4 out of 5. Check out my YouTube video to see more of my thoughts on this fine brew.
Brewer Notes:
This dangerously drinkable garnet beauty is a hop lover’s delight. The intense dry-hop nose and the alcohol content are perfectly balanced for a caramel malt backbone. This is a serious beer for serious beer aficionados. Oink!
AVAILABILITY: Year-round: 4-pack, 22-ounce and draft
IBU/ABV: 104 (Untappd)/9.2%
HOPS: Columbus
MALTS: 2-Row and C-80
YEAST: London Ale
SUGGESTED PAIRINGS: BBQ Nachos - Hog's hops cut the fattiness of the cheese, and its maltiness is a beautiful complement to the smoked meats.
